CoD: Warzone 2 And Modern Warfare 2 Update Delivers More Fixes For Crashes And Bugs

More crashing and bug fixes arrive ahead of the Season 2 launch for Modern Warfare 2 and Warzone 2.

A new update arrived to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 and Warzone 2 on January 30, addressing several bugs and crashing issues across multiplayer, battle royale, and DMZ. The full patch notes can be seen below, but one of the main focuses was to increase stability and deliver crash fixes across all platforms.

According to the patch notes, this update contains several fixes to reduce the number of known crashes across both games. One specific stability issue mentioned to be fixed was a bug that previously caused some players to crash when dismissing a notification.

The update also addressed an issue that caused some players to have difficulty accessing and leaving the Firing Range. Additionally, there was a fix for an issue in the Gunsmith, which could cause players to be kicked back to the main menu while creating a custom knife.

A few navigation and menu improvements were included. Various fixes were made to the Social menu to improve navigation and functionality, a UI issue was addressed that caused text overlap, and incorrect Calling Card previews have now been adjusted.

A few Warzone and DMZ specific updates were made as well. The patch notes mentioned a fix for a bug that sometimes caused players to lose movement when deploying a Recon Drone near water. The update also addressed multiple issues impacting the ability to equip and preview insured weapons in DMZ.

The full patch notes can be found below, as shared on Activision's blog post.

These changes follow the January 20 update that also provided more stability and fixes to both games, including a fix for the previously frustrating chat bug. All of the improvements are arriving ahead of the Season 2 update, which was delayed by two weeks to give the developers more time to implement changes based on player feedback. The big update now arrives on February 15, and here we highlight all the details and rumors about Season 2 of Modern Warfare 2 and Warzone 2.

GENERAL

  • Crashes
    • ​​This update contains several fixes to reduce the number of known crashes. We continue to prioritize increased stability and crash fixes across all platforms.

BUG FIXES

  • Fixed an issue that showed Weapon Decals and Stickers as blocked.
  • Fixed an issue where using Spotter Scope could cause target markers to persist when aimed down sights with a Weapon.
  • Fixed an issue allowing the Sentry Gun to be placed inside a tank to eliminate enemies.
  • Fixed an issue where Gun Screens weren’t showing correctly on the Gunsmith UI tile.
  • Fixed an issue in the Gunsmith where Players could be kicked back to the main menu when creating a custom knife.
  • Fixed an issue in Gunsmith that could cause knife variants to display incorrectly.
  • Fixed an issue that prevented some Players from saving a custom mod while trying to select a Camo.
  • Fixed an issue causing some Players to crash when dismissing a notification.
  • Fixed some issues Players were having with accessing and leaving the Firing Range.

Navigation Improvements

  • Addressed various issues with the Social menu to improve navigation and functionality.
  • Fixed an issue preventing some users from navigating through the Friends/Recent tab after scrolling over the top row.
  • Fixed an issue where Calling Card previews are not displaying correctly in the challenge completion animation.
  • Fixed a UI issue causing text overlap in the After Action Report.

WARZONE 2.0

BUG FIXES

  • Fixed an issue where deploying a Recon Drone near water could cause some Players to lose movement.

DMZ

  • Fixed an issue causing the Rewards section of the Faction Mission menu to display incorrectly.
  • Addressed a number of issues impacting the functionality and navigation of equipping and previewing Insured Weapons.
  • Fixed an issue where Players could not access Gunsmith to change camos when equipping a Launcher in an Insured Weapon slot.
